

Gloria Jean Klinger passed away peacefully on March 28th, 2026, at providence hospital with her family by her side. She was born in Everett, WA to Clarence “Buck” Bradburn and Doratha “Babe” (Craig) Bradburn. Gloria grew up in Lake McMurray, WA in a house by the water and attended school in Conway. She married Bill Klinger on October 4th, 1954, in Arlington, WA. Gloria was 6 months along with her oldest son William “Buddy” when she found out her father Clarence had cancer. She came back to Washington on the train, and he sadly passed at the age of 50 and was unable to meet his grandchildren. Gloria later welcomed Daryl Klinger and Doreen (Petersen) into the world. Gloria had a deep love for caring for others throughout her life. Her grandchildren loved spending time at Grandma’s house and helping her make her famous salmon cakes along with other treats like pumpkin pie and cookies. Gloria had a special touch like no other. If her grandchildren did not normally like vegetables, they would just gobble them up at grandma’s house. Her whole family loved listening to her play both the acoustic and electric guitars as well as the organ. Gloria had many hobbies and interests, including painting, crafting, and feeding the birds in her backyard, with hummingbirds being her favorite. She would paint fairytale houses on rocks and display them in her living room for all to enjoy. She was so generous that he started to feed a family a raccoons on her deck. Until one day a raccoon grabbed her leg from under the steps! Needless to say, that ended her feeding times with the neighborhood raccoons.
